I am an alumnus of NIT Jamshedpur. Based on my experiences, here are a few pros and cons of joining this institution-
NIT Jamshedpur has a very good environment. Its faculty, curriculum and placements are good as well. Tata steel and Tata Cummins are located near the college campus. This enhances training and industrial exposure opportunities for the students. The college hostels are newly built, and filled with good facilities.
However, the infrastructure and campus maintenance need to improve. Also, workshops aren’t regularly conducted for some of the branches.
Overall, NIT Jamshedpur is a good college, and you can definitely consider it for your engineering studies.

The B.Tech placement figures of NIT Jamshedpur have been quite good in the recent years. This is especially true for CSE, ECE and EEE. NIT Jamshedpur is one of the few NITs (apart from the top 3), which perform well in their core branch placements. This may be due to its industrial location.
Last year, in 2023, the highest package of 83.4 LPA was recorded by B.Tech CSE, ECE and EEE. Mechanical recorded the highest package of 21 LPA, Metallurgical and Materials recorded it at 14 LPA, Civil at 20 LPA, and Production and Industrial at 22 LPA.
The average package for B.Tech CSE was 26.63 LPA, and for ECE, it was 22.03 LPA. ECE, EEE, Mechanical and Metallurgical reported 100% placements. CSE reported 97.20% placements. Alstom, Tata Motors, Tata Cummins, KPMG, Adobe, etc. were some of the top recruiters for the 2023 placement season.

My friend recently graduated from NIT Jamshedpur. Here is her review.
Location: The campus is located in Adityapur, surrounded by industries. It is a bit away from Tatanagar Railway Station. Since Jamshedpur doesn’t have an airport the best way to reach the campus is from Ranchi via NH-33.
Infrastructure-wise: Both the hostels and the computer centers are revamped. The main buildings of the campus are still under further development but are expected to be in maintenance soon. However, the mega hostels, known as J & K, are an enhanced sight of the campus.

Extracurricular Activities:
The TechnoManagement fest, Ojass, and Cultural fest, Culfest are the major events of the institute. There are several automobile teams as well, like Team Phoenix, the aircraft team; Team Rays, the hybrid car team and Team Daksh, Off road car team.
